Abstract
PURPOSE:To improve focussing characteristics by making an opposed electrode which forms the principal focussing lens of a collective three-electron gun consisting of thick and thin porous plate-type members with beam pass holes and the members which support them. CONSTITUTION:The opposed electrode elements of the third and fourth grids 44 and 45 which form the principal focussing lens of a collective three-electron gun 38 consist of the first members 442a and 45a and the second members 442b and 45b. The first members are formed it long cylindrical members consisting of a flange section 55, side wall section 56, and implantation section and a thick porous plate- type member 442b (second member) with beam pass holes 52, 53, and 54 is mounted on its flange section 55 of a thickness of l. This enables punching of the second member and improvement of the roundness of the beam pass holes. As a result, the effective length l of the electron gun lens is increased and its focussing characteristics are improved.
